Heitor Villa-Lobos' Ave Maria was composed in 1914 for voice and string quartet (2 violins, 1 viola, 1 violoncelo, preferably a small string orchestra muted). This edition provides the full score and all parts with the bowings marked by Dr. Zoltan Paulinyi, with the lyrics in Latin added below the original ones in Portuguese.
(The original Villa-Lobos' copyright of 1952 for this piece expired in 1981 in USA, as explained here
https://www.copyright.gov/circs/circ15a.pdf ).
